Some users are getting an error message when opening 2 documents based
on a particular template.

"Unknown programming error. Error=[0x80070057]"

This message comes up again when switching between word and other
programs.

We're using Word 2002, Windows XP Pro.

The problem seems to be machine specific and it works fine on the
majority of computers here. The template doesn't have any VBA that
would initialise when switching windows.
